Output 6deadfc35deaaa592216be0020fac05669af16128c369637c39d553125e66ee5:9

value
175805236
script pubkey
OP_0 OP_PUSHBYTES_32 3b05b90ca48383f30582bf600af3ac31774386af1428aac71f5637b639dec5f7
address
bc1q8vzmjr9yswplxpvzhasq4uavx9m58p40zs5243cl2cmmvww7chmsvkq9wt
transaction
6deadfc35deaaa592216be0020fac05669af16128c369637c39d553125e66ee5
spent
true